PwC is the leading auditing and consulting company in Germany. As an independent member of the international PwC network, it offers its services worldwide. PwC audits and advises leading industrial and service companies of all sizes. In Germany, over 15,000 employees generate revenues of more than three billion euros in the divisions of audit and audit-related services (assurance solutions), tax and legal advice (tax & legal solutions), transformation, risk & regulatory, sustainability, cloud & digital, and deals. The experts in the different service lines work together across all divisions and from different offices in Germany, making it possible to meet with them individually at 20 locations nationwide. Also part of PwC is Strategy& – a global team of practice-oriented strategists. You can find more information about our team of strategy advisors here: https://www.strategyand.pwc.com/ Thanks to its worldwide network, PwC is able to provide its clients with professional services around the world and to offer cross-border support. As an independent member of this network, PwC Germany has access to more than 365,000 employees in 136 countries. Straive is a global leader in AI-driven value creation, business transformation, and Global Capability Center (GCC) delivery — empowering private-equity portfolio companies, mid-market firms, and enterprises with scalable, technology-enabled execution. We serve clients across industries, including Banking, Financial and Information Services, Retail, Media and Technology, EdTech, Science and Research, Logistics and Supply Chain, and Pharma & Life Sciences. Our strategically placed team of 18,000 employees operates in nine countries: the Philippines, India, the United States, Nicaragua, Vietnam, the United Kingdom, Singapore, South Africa, and Canada. We have been recognized as a Star Performer in Data & AI Services Specialists – Everest’s North America PEAK Matrix 2025, and as a Leader in AIM’s Pema Quadrant of Agentic AI Service Providers – 2025. In Nov 2023, Straive acquired Gramener, an award-winning, design-led data science company, enhancing our data, analytics, and AI capabilities. In June 2025, we acquired SG Analytics, a leading provider of AI-powered insights and contextual analytics services. Improper Verification of Cryptographic Signature in ueberauth guardian allows an unauthenticated attacker to revoke a victim's session with a forged token. Guardian.revoke/3 in lib/guardian.ex decodes the supplied token with peek/1, which performs no signature verification (it only base64-decodes the JWT header and payload). The resulting unverified claims are forwarded directly to the configured token module's revoke callback and the implementation's on_revoke callback, a state-mutating sink. The sibling operations refresh/2 and exchange/4 both call decode_and_verify first, so the signature is checked before anything acts on the claims; revoke/3 is the only state-mutating path that acts on claims without verifying the signature. An attacker who knows or guesses a victim's identifying claim values (jti, sub) can forge a JWT carrying those claims, sign it with an arbitrary key, and submit it to any endpoint that funnels a caller-supplied token into Guardian.revoke/3 (the standard logout / session-revocation pattern). When the token module mutates state keyed by the claims (whitelist deletion or blacklist insertion, for example a GuardianDb-style store), the victim's legitimate session is evicted. This is an unauthenticated session-revocation denial of service; the attacker never needs the signing secret. This issue affects guardian: from 1.0.0 before 2.4.1.
Allocation of Resources Without Limits or Throttling vulnerability in ueberauth guardian (Guardian.Permissions module) allows a denial of service via BEAM atom-table exhaustion. This vulnerability is associated with program file lib/guardian/permissions.ex and program routines 'Elixir.Guardian.Permissions':encode_permissions!/1, 'Elixir.Guardian.Permissions':encode_permissions_into_claims!/2, 'Elixir.Guardian.Permissions':do_encode_permissions!/2. The Guardian.Permissions mixin installs a public encode_permissions!/1 function on every module that does use Guardian.Permissions. For each key of the supplied map, encode_permissions!/1 calls String.to_atom(to_string(k)) before any validation runs. The integer-value clause of do_encode_permissions!/2 then short-circuits straight to encoding without validating the key against the configured permission set, so a key with an integer value is interned as a fresh atom with no exception raised. Atoms are never garbage collected and the BEAM atom table is a fixed-size resource (default roughly 1,048,576 entries), so each unique attacker-chosen key permanently consumes one slot. An attacker who can influence a permission map that reaches encode_permissions!/1 (for example a permissions map read from a request body and passed into token issuance via encode_permissions_into_claims!/2) can mint an unbounded number of atoms and exhaust the atom table, crashing the entire BEAM node and every service running on it. The sibling decode_permissions/1 is not affected because it skips keys absent from the configured permission set. This issue affects guardian: from 2.0.0 before 2.4.1.
Allocation of Resources Without Limits or Throttling in ueberauth guardian allows denial of service via unbounded atom creation from attacker-controlled binary input. Guardian.Permissions.AtomEncoding encodes permission scopes by passing arbitrary binaries to String.to_atom/1. When encode/3 in lib/guardian/permissions/atom_encoding.ex is called with a list, each binary entry is handled by the encode_value/3 binary clause, which calls String.to_atom(value) with no allow-list check. The perm_set argument (the application's small, finite set of legitimate permission names) is discarded, so any external string flows straight into atom creation. This encoder is selected with use Guardian.Permissions, encoding: Guardian.Permissions.AtomEncoding and reached through the imported encode/3 entry point. String.to_atom/1 creates a brand-new atom for every previously unseen binary, atoms are never garbage collected, and the BEAM atom table is fixed at roughly 1,048,576 entries by default. An application that funnels attacker-influenced permission scopes (from a request body, a JWT claim, or other external input) into encode/3 therefore mints one permanent atom per distinct value. A modest stream of varied, unauthenticated input permanently consumes the atom table and crashes the BEAM node with system_limit, taking down every application running on it. The default encoder is Guardian.Permissions.BitwiseEncoding, which is not affected. This issue affects guardian: from 2.0.0 before 2.4.1.
Allocation of Resources Without Limits or Throttling in ueberauth guardian allows denial of service via unbounded atom creation from attacker-influenced binary input. Guardian.Plug.Keys derives connection and session namespace keys by passing arbitrary binaries to String.to_atom/1. base_key/1 in lib/guardian/plug/keys.ex converts any binary into the atom :"guardian_<input>", and the derived helpers claims_key/1, resource_key/1, and token_key/1 create a second atom on top of that. key_from_other/1 likewise converts a regex-captured binary through String.to_atom/1. The public specs advertise String.t() as a valid argument, so passing a string is documented usage, and higher-level entry points such as Guardian.Plug.current_token(conn, key: key) thread the caller-supplied key straight into these functions. String.to_atom/1 creates a brand-new atom for every previously unseen binary, atoms are never garbage collected, and the BEAM atom table is fixed at roughly 1,048,576 entries by default. An application that routes attacker-influenced data (a tenant identifier, header, or other request input) into a Guardian key therefore mints one permanent atom per distinct value. A modest stream of varied, unauthenticated input permanently consumes the atom table and crashes the BEAM node, taking down every application running on it. This issue affects guardian: from 0.1.0 before 2.4.1.
